Accordingly, can you use smaller disc on angle grinder?
The size of the disc should have a direct bearing on your choice of angle grinder. The two most common disc sizes are 4.5” (115mm) and 9” (230mm). Grinders with larger discs are particularly well suited to heavy-duty applications, whereas those with smaller discs are ideal for finer work.
Also, how deep can a 125mm angle grinder cut?
All in all, 125mm angle grinders are extremely versatile tools despite their limited cutting depth of just 38 mm. While 115mm angle grinders offer a maximum cutting depth of only 30 mm, they are precise, easy to handle and lighter than larger versions.
How deep can a 4.5 inch angle grinder cut?
A 4.5 angle grinder has a blade that is 4.5-inches in diameter. This means the blade extends 2.25-inches for the center in each direction. As a result, it is not physically able to cut through 4 inch concrete. Select a larger grinder when a deep cuts are necessary, such as a 9-inch grinder.

How many amp angle grinder do I need?
Five or six amps is common on mid-range angle grinders, but some are as high as 11 amps. Larger models can reach 14 amps, which is a practical limit since standard electrical outlets only provide a 15-amp maximum supply.

What is the best size of angle grinder for home use?
The most commonly used sizes are the 4” and 4 ½”. These grinders typically have the capacity for wheel diameters of up to 7”, with particularly small versions having the capacity for 3” discs.
What is the best wattage for angle grinder?
With respect to the various activities you should allow for the following wattages:
- for polishing: 500 watts.
- for grinding: 1,000 watts.
- for cutting through simple materials: 1,500 watts.
- for cutting through strong metals: 2,500 watts.
